Maymon not eligible yet
               




Former MU forward Jeronne Maymon isn't eligible at Tennessee just yet, according to this report by the Knoxville News.

QuoteMaymon, who transferred to UT last year from Marquette, said he was told he couldn't get cleared because UT is still within an academic window where grades can be changed.

"They told me that, but I've got e-mails from all of my teachers saying nothing will be added or subtracted from any of my grades,'' Maymon said. "They gave me their home numbers and everything if anyone wants to ask.

"I got up at 6:30 this morning to meet with my (academic) advisor to see what could be done, but apparently someone is dead-set against me playing tomorrow (Saturday).''
